telnet什么协议(深入了解Telnet协议)
深入了解Telnet协议
什么是Telnet协议
Telnet(电传打印机网络协议)是一种在Internet上运行的客户/服务器协议。它是TCP/IP协议栈中的一部分,并被用来在远程计算机之间提供虚拟终端连接,允许用户在一个计算机上,通过网络连接另一个计算机。它是一个开放协议,可以用不同的软件实现,从而提供远程访问的功能。Telnet协议的工作原理
Telnet协议工作方式非常简单,它通过建立两个连接来实现。客户端使用一个TCP连接连接到服务器上,通常是在23号端口。一旦连接建立,客户端就可以向服务器发送命令,并接收服务器的响应。这种方式类似于你在终端上直接与服务器进行交互,也就是说,你可以在远程计算机上执行和调试命令行程序。Telnet协议的用途
Telnet协议的安全性问题
尽管Telnet协议非常方便,但它也存在一些安全性问题。因为连接是以明文形式传输的,所以攻击者可以截取你的用户名和密码,从而获得对远程计算机的访问权限。此外,Telnet协议还容易受到中间人攻击的威胁,因为任何人都可以通过连接截获通信内容,并对其进行篡改。为了解决这些安全性问题,很多人现在采用了SSH(安全外壳协议)来取代Telnet协议。SSH协议在传输和认证过程中使用了加密,从而可以保证数据传输的安全。此外,SSH还支持远程文件传输和压缩,以及许多其他有用的功能,使得它成为了一个强大而安全的远程访问工具。